“You are really something else. I can’t believe you managed to stir up such chaos in my absence.”
Hannah narrowed her eyes, feigning innocence. “I’m not sure what you’re referring to. Care to enlighten me?”
“What do I mean? Miss Moore, don’t have the nerve to own up to it? You caused quite a scene at Jade Paradise yesterday, and now you’re too cowardly to admit it.”
“Oh.” Hannah drummed her fingertips on the table. “So that’s what this is about.”
She met Amelie’s gaze squarely. “I’ve heard that the police rescued some innocent girls from the basement of your Jade Paradise yesterday. Ms. Chadwick, I had no idea you were involved in such shady dealings. You’re already under investigation, and now this situation? You are digging yourself an even deeper hole.”
“You!”

Amelie nearly lost her composure before regaining control. She spoke slowly, her tone icy. “Hannah, don’t think you can outmaneuver me. You’re in serious trouble now.”

Hannah maintained her calm demeanor as she looked at Amelie. “I’ve never shied away from trouble. I’m more concerned that you won’t have any way out of this. Given the number of people rescued yesterday, I imagine you’ll have quite a few accusations lining up against you, won’t you?”
Hannah glanced at her phone deliberately before speaking slowly. “If I recall correctly, you could’ve posted bail and walked free today. What a shame.”
She offered a pointed smile at Amelie before continuing, “With the discovery of the captivity and abduction of numerous young girls at your establishment, it seems you won’t be leaving here anytime soon, will you?”
Struggling to maintain her composure, Amelie fought to keep her voice steady. “Do you realize that your actions will also bring harm to the Compton family? Do you think they could live peacefully if I suffer?”
With a glint of satisfaction in her eyes, Hannah replied to Amelie with deliberate calmness, “I couldn’t care less about the Compton family’s troubles. As long as you’re suffering, I’ll be content. Even if the Compton family faces challenges, Wallace will handle it. They’ll be just fine.”
Resting her chin on her hand, Hannah fixed her gaze on Amelie. “Once the charges against the Chadwick family are proven true, do you think Wallace will continue to defend you?”
Amelie seethed with anger, rendered speechless by Hannah’s words.
Glancing at her phone, noting it was only half-past nine, Hannah rose from her seat. “My time is valuable. I won’t waste it here with you.”
After her statement, Hannah turned on her heel, ready to leave.
Amelie’s resentful voice pierced the air behind her.
“You think you can bring me down like this? The Chadwick family won’t let you off. You’ll only make enemies of us by doing this.”
“Is that so?”
Hannah halted, pivoted, and gave Amelie a scornful look. “Then I’ll eagerly await it. Don’t hold back on my account.”
With a loud bang, the door shut.
With Hannah no longer in the room, Amelie struggled to contain her boiling emotions, feeling a sense of turmoil within.
As the policeman escorted Hannah out, he delivered some promising news.
The majority of the girls rescued from Jade Paradise last night are willing to testify that Amelie held them captive in the basement.
Even if they couldn’t directly implicate Amelie, this testimony could still spell trouble for her.
Hannah flashed a grateful smile and thanked the policeman before driving off.
Her journey was smooth until she reached a bridge. Glancing at the rearview mirror, her expression darkened.
Since leaving the police station, four black cars had trailed her without fail. It was clear they were after her.
